Output 5efc9d314c7e6aa6296400a81dca0a97d7daae9f8acaa08ca6d9a932c3164271:0

value
77351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33e38f08dcfa53a841f41fa61facc611abc74c58 OP_EQUAL
address
36RNzPGfFALUWfSPhyNw4VKcXqUHFsnv9z
transaction
5efc9d314c7e6aa6296400a81dca0a97d7daae9f8acaa08ca6d9a932c3164271
confirmations
222914
spent
true